Self-driving to Yuntai Mountain in September Weekend 2-day Tour

DAY 1 9/15 Itinerary:
🚗 Tianjin → Yuntai Mountain Anshang Service Area (📍 Shaqiang Village North 2 km, Qixian Town, Xiuwu County, Jiaozuo City)
✅ Buy tickets in advance on Trip.com (💰180 RMB/3-day pass), easy entry with ID card! Scenic shuttle buses inside the park go chua~chua directly to all attractions㊙️
✅ Surprise discovery: prices in the park are super affordable, a bowl of knife-cut noodles only 15 RMB💰 so reasonable💕

🌟 Must-check route recommendation👇
🌈 Hongshi Gorge → Zifang Lake
The Danxia landform of Hongshi Gorge is stunning and breathtaking! Every snap is wallpaper-worthy✨
💧 Zifang Lake is as blue as a painting, the lake and mountain scenery made me cry😭 (Boat ride 50 RMB/person)

🌄 Zhuyu Peak Cable Car Up → Climb the popular Zhuyu Peak
Cable car 70 RMB/person, saves effort, thrilling and scenic! The view of the sea of clouds from the top is absolutely amazing🤩 (Recommended to go before 10 AM)
⛰️ Phoenix Ridge Cable Car Down
Avoid peak times to enjoy the cable car scenery, a perfect end to day one✌️

✨ DAY 2 9/16 Itinerary:
🐒 Have fun all day at Xiaozhaigou Scenic Area~
✅ Monkey Valley slide round trip (40 RMB/person round trip, a must for kids! Super thrilling)
✅ Check in at Tanpu Gorge’s "Sky Mirror" for a heart photo🤳 (Best time 10 AM)
✅ Stroll the quiet trail at Quanpu Gorge (about 1.5 hours)
✅ Yuntai Heavenly Waterfall is spectacular✨ (📍 Deepest part of the park, 314 meters drop)

⚠️ Park opening hours:
March-November: 7:00-17:30 (last entry 17:00)
December-February: 7:30-17:30 (park closes 16:30)

✨ Tips:
1️⃣ Remember to bring your ID card + sunscreen + sports shoes
2️⃣ The park requires walking throughout, comfortable shoes are very important!
3️⃣ On weekends, it’s recommended to enter before 8 AM to avoid crowds
